Jermine is a boy's name. In 2002 it was given to 5 babies in the United States. It was given to fewer than five babies in the most recent year of published US data.
- Peaked in 1979, when 27 babies were given the name.
- It has largely dropped out of use.
- First appears in US birth records in 1971.
Jermine over time
Births per decade in the United States, 1970s to 2000s. The striped bar is the 2000s, still in progress — it covers 2000 to 2002, not a full ten years.
Show the numbers
| Decade | Births |
|---|---|
| 1970s | 144 |
| 1980s | 158 |
| 1990s | 53 |
| 2000s (to 2002) | 17 |

US figures omit any name given to fewer than five babies in a year, so the rarest names are absent from the source rather than absent from use. Data & sources.
